Red Snout Emperor, Lethrinus reticulatus Valenciennes 1830


Summary:
An olive-grey to tan emperor, often with scattered irregular black blotches, a brown or olive head with an indistinct reddish band on the snout, and the upper edge of the operculum, pectoral-fin base sometimes the rear edge of the preoperculum red.

Distribution

Northwest Shelf, Western Australia, to off Cape York, Queensland. Elsewhere the species occurs in the Indo-west Pacific: Mauritius, Chagos, west Thailand, Taiwan, the Ryukyu Islands, the Philippines and Northern Marianas to Indonesia, Papua New Guinea and Samoa. 
Inhabits shallow areas with soft substrates near coral reefs.

Feeding

Feeds on benthic invertebrates and small fishes.

Species Citation

Lethrinus reticulatus Valenciennes, in Cuvier & Valenciennes 1830, Histoire Naturelle des Poissons: 298. Type locality: New Guinea.
